Ethical conduct and the professional's dilemma: choosing between service and success

New York: Quorum Books (1991)
  Copy   BIBTEX

Abstract

McDowell offers an unusually frank discussion of the ethical principles that should govern decisions and analyzes the pressures that drive some professionals to sell unnecessary or excessive services.
